Complexes of manganese borohydride with the borohydrides of organic cations

Conclusions

  1. 1.

    Reaction of MnCBH4)2(THF)3 with tetrabutylammoniura and tetraphenylphosphonium borohydndes, and with tetraphenylphosphonium chloride, has given the compounds (Bu4N)[Mn(BH4)3], (Ph4P)[Mn(BH4)3], (Ph4P)[Mn(BH4)3(THF)], (Ph4P) [Mn(BH4)3Cl], and (Ph4P) [Mn(BH4)2Cl(THF)], which have been characterized by IR spectroscopy and thermogravimetric studies.

  2. 2.

    The crystal and molecular structure of the manganese complex (Ph4P) [Mn(BH4)3−xClx (THF)] (x∼ 0.5) has been found.
